#1ba80a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ba80a is composed of 10.6% red, 65.9%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 94%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 113.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 34.9%. #1ba80a color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ff14 with #005100.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#1ba80a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ba80a has RGB values of R:27, G:168,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 1812490.

Shades and Tints of #1ba80a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f0feee is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ba80a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565d55 is the less saturated color, while #16af03 is the most saturated one.
